winapi

Die Windows-API (früher als Win32-API bezeichnet) ist der Kernsatz von Anwendungsprogrammierschnittstellen, die für die Microsoft Windows-Betriebssysteme verfügbar sind. Mit diesem Tag können Sie Fragen zur Entwicklung nativer Windows-Anwendungen mit der Windows-API beantworten.
2
Antworten

WM_QUIT nur Beiträge für den Thread und nicht das Fenster?

In der Windows API untersuche ich, wie die Funktion GetMessage tatsächlich funktioniert. Ich habe 3 Implementierungen der Windows-Nachrichtenschleife gesehen und möchte sie erkunden. 1) Zum Zeitpunkt des Schreibens dieses Posts dies...
24.09.2015, 19:00
6
Antworten

Enthält GetTickCount () die Zeit, die für den Status suspended oder hibernated verbracht wurde?

Zur Verdeutlichung meine ich die Zeit, die verbraucht wurde, während das System angehalten / überwintert wurde, nicht den aufrufenden Thread (GetTickCount () gibt die Anzahl der Millisekunden seit Systemstart zurück).     
04.02.2009, 20:15
2
Antworten

ListBox, die mit WinAPI in VBA erstellt wurde, funktioniert nicht

Ich möchte eine ListBox in VBA mit WinAPI erstellen. Ich habe es geschafft, es zu erstellen, aber ListBox reagiert nicht auf Aktionen - kein Scrollen, keine Auswahl. Nichts davon funktioniert. Es sieht so aus, als ob es deaktiviert ist. Wie kann...
10.02.2018, 14:36
1
Antwort

Delphi 10 Seattle wechselt zu Win32 GetPath und redundanten TPoint- und _POINTL-Record-Typen

Ich versuche, Code, der in Delphi XE8 funktioniert, nach Delphi 10 Seattle zu portieren. Dieser Code ruft die GetPath-Funktion in Winapi.Windows auf. Die neue Signatur der Win32-API-Funktion lautet: %Vor% In XE8 hatte die Funktion zuvor "...
01.09.2015, 13:37
1
Antwort

Wie entwickle ich eine COM-Schnittstelle?

COM ist bekannt dafür, Abwärtskompatibilität bei der Veröffentlichung neuer Komponenten oder Anwendungen zu ermöglichen. Dies ist möglich, weil die Schnittstellen in COM stabil sind, d. H. Sie ändern sich nicht. Ich habe mich bemüht, eine Ref...
25.10.2009, 13:33
2
Antworten

fchown () unter Windows scheint unmöglich in C zu implementieren

* UPDATE * Die Antworten waren sehr hilfreich und jetzt gibt mein Code ERROR_SUCCESS zurück. Die Schlüsseländerung schien zu SetKernelObjectSecurity() zu wechseln. Jetzt sehe ich jedoch ein anderes Problem; Mein Code ist erfolgreich,...
28.07.2014, 23:26
4
Antworten

Kann VC ++ 2010 nicht deinstallieren: Fehler: Eine neuere Version von Microsoft Visual C ++ 2010 Redistributable wurde auf dem Computer erkannt

Ich versuche, das Microsoft Windows SDK für Windows 7 und .NET Framework 4 zu installieren. Es schlägt fehl und beschwert sich über den Fehler 5100, auf den unter Ссылка " Dieser Link besagt, dass Microsoft Visual C ++ 2010 x86 Redistributable...
01.05.2013, 04:10
1
Antwort

Wie erkennt man Tippen (Eingabe) global anstelle von Mausklick?

Ich möchte eine App erstellen, die angezeigt wird, wenn der Benutzer seinen Bildschirm berührt. Es sollte nicht für Klick funktionieren. Ich habe nach den Berührungshilfen in Windows 7/8 gesucht. Aber ich habe gesehen, dass jedes Touch-Fenster m...
12.01.2013, 19:53
2
Antworten

Unterstützt winapis bcrypt.h tatsächlich bcrypt hashing?

Das hört sich vielleicht nach einer seltsamen Frage an, und es fühlt sich ein bisschen seltsam an, dass ich das wirklich fragen muss, aber nachdem ich ein paar Stunden über die MSDN-Dokumentation für die in Vista hinzugefügten bcrypt -Routine...
14.03.2012, 22:57
4
Antworten

Große C # -Quelldatei mit Windows-API-Methodensignaturen, -Strukturen, -Konstanten: Werden sie alle in der endgültigen .exe-Datei enthalten sein?

Ich möchte alle Signaturen von Windows-API-Funktionen, die ich in Programmen in einer Klasse verwende, wie WinAPI, und in eine Datei WinAPI.cs, die ich in meine Projekte aufnehmen werde. Die Klasse wird internal static und die Methoden public...
30.11.2010, 14:37